How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Godley?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Godley Studio Apartments | $1,812 | $850 | $4,360 |
Godley 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,867 | $949 | $4,939 |
Godley 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,230 | $643 | $5,039 |
Godley 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,829 | $753 | $3,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Godley Apartments with Swimming Pool
How much is the average rent for Godley Apartments with Swimming Pool?
The average rent for a Apartment in Godley with Swimming Pool is $1,397.
What is the largest Godley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?
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Godley is a 1,215 square feet unit starting from $995 at Larkin Village.
What is the average size for Godley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?
The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Godley is currently at 449 sq ft.
